Preparing to download firmware
- Identify exact device model and hardware revision: Firmware is often model- and revision-specific. Record device model number, hardware version, serial number, and current firmware version.
- Backup configuration and data: Export settings and back up any user data in case the update resets device state.
- Power and connectivity: Ensure reliable power (use an uninterrupted power source if possible) and a stable download connection to avoid interruptions during flashing.
- Release notes and compatibility: Read the firmware release notes to confirm the update addresses needed fixes and is compatible with your device and environment. Note any required intermediate updates (some devices require sequential upgrades).
- Prepare recovery tools: Obtain the device’s recovery/bootloader tools and instructions (e.g., serial console, JTAG, manufacturer recovery image) in case update fails.
